1.1 Sins of the Past

The Warrior Princess, of Hercules fame, gets her own show!
For the first time, we see Lucy Lawless explode onto screen in a new costume and with a new attitude. She wants to give up her warrior ways! This, however, lasts all of ten minutes when, after burying her leathers, armour and weapons, she comes across a bunch of Draco's men who have captured a group of innocent villagers to sell as slaves.
Amongst those villagers is a young girl called Gabrielle who isn't quite as helpless as she seems... Needless to say, Xena jumps in with some cool acrobatic moves and hand to hand techniques and saves the day, but Gabrielle wants the warrior to take her with her. After refusing point black, Xena takes off and heads toward home with Gabrielle following her. The young girl from Poteidaia arrives to find that Xena's kinsmen and mother are trying to stone her for her past misdeeds and jumps in, showing the Warrior Princess that she's more than just a pretty face. She uses her skills as a bard to talk the people into giving a Xena a second chance and, after saving her home village, Amphipolis, from the warlord Draco, the warrior finally makes up with her mother... and gains a friend in the chatty, happy Gabrielle.
There are some touching scenes in this episode... for example, Xena goes to her brother's tomb to explain how she's feeling to him. She tells him it's hard to be alone but then a voice at the door speaks to her saying... "You're not alone."
And so begins the great friendship that is Xena, Warrior Princess and Gabrielle, Bard of Poteidaia.
